thoughts from April 1st:
The most wonderful people I have met are the elderly Christians. We so rarely listen to their stories, their walk, but they shine with a beauty that makes me jealous. They glow with God's love, and give off that love so freely.
By contrast, there is nothing uglier than an elderly non-believer. Anger and hate seep out from them like a draining wound. No one likes them...and they poison the atmosphere around them.
My life is so different. Yes, I am dealing with a chronic disease, am limited in mobility AND what I can do without making myself flare. Just the other day I did dishes and loads of laundry and had a flare. Having rheumatoid arthritis and fibromyalgia means anything and everything costs much more than it did. And in a way I am relieved to know that the exhaustion I have felt building the last ten years was not in my head after all.
More importantly, my life is different because of the steps made with God. When hard times hit, we do one of two things, or maybe more like four. We hunker down like mini-gods to fight it out ourselves, give up and hide in a hole, rage at God without accepting His grace, and lastly, accepting His grace.
Sometimes we do all of these, so certain that we can handle everything. After all, aren't we told that by the media and any readings we do? Everything should happen as WE want it.
I have had a lot of experience in leaning on God. Giving in to His strength, love, and grace is so much easier. Honestly, life is too impossible to survive without a "god"; life hurts too much. We may choose to numb with alcohol, drugs, porn, movies...whatever can addict us and numb us from the pain of life.
There is a huge difference though. Those things may, as it were, make us "happy" in the passing......but only God can make us happy in the midst of suffering. He alone will give us peace and joy at the hardest of times. Those other "gods" will, if anything, make the hurts of the world that much worse.
So we must lean on the Lord. After all, He took our sins upon Himself, He can most assuredly take our hand in His and help us walk the way to Paradise.
